When Cheek left the stage, she had a fresh $1 million dedication from investor Lori Greiner. And the company is wowing more than just the tv judges. Everly, Well gathered $6 million in sales last year, a spokeswoman stated, and Cheek told the judges that this year they anticipated that to double.

All are thought about laboratory-developed tests, and are for that reason not managed by the Fda. ad Yet physician groups have actually for years encouraged against using immunoglobulin G tests to examine for so-called food sensitivities or intolerances. And allergy specialists told STAT that the test is useless at best and could even cause damage if it leads consumers to needlessly cut healthy foods from their diet plan.

Food level of sensitivity is an umbrella term that includes symptoms that can arise, for example, from trouble absorbing a food, as in lactose intolerance, or susceptibility to the effect of a food, as in caffeine sensitivity. These signs, nevertheless, do not include an immune action. (Food allergies, on the other hand, have more severe symptoms and are driven by the body immune system; verified tests for them do exist.) Dr. Martha Hartz, a specialist at Mayo Center in Rochester, Minn., says she regularly examines clients who have actually already forked over the money for the screening. "Anytime I see a client who's had these type of tests, we get them to toss it aside," Hartz said.

It is simply not a test that ought to done." Everly, Well's food sensitivity test uses a blood sample to search for immune system activity. Everly, Well Everly, Well's test is simply one entry to the thriving field of at-home testing. Together with gamers in the hereditary space, such as 23and, Me and Color Genomics, upstarts are taking goal at standard medical testing.

Everly, Well's food sensitivity tests exploit an aggravating reality for those questioning whether their signs come from the food they consume: There is no easy way to find a response. The doctor-advised method is to cut typical wrongdoers from the diet plan one by one a so-called removal diet plan but that is cumbersome, lengthy, and, by its very nature, limiting.

When an individual sees the doctor to find out about possible food intolerances, they'll likely be upset to find that the cash they spent on food sensitivity testing purchased online or at an "alternative" practitioner's office was cash down the drain. "The majority of patients in the end, when we have actually done our workup and develop a plan," Hartz stated, "are actually rather annoyed that they spent all this money on an useless test.".

What's really fascinating about food sensitivities is that symptoms typically do not look like quickly as you eat the problem food. Rather, you might have symptoms hours or days after consuming that food which can make it difficult to connect particular foods to the signs you're experiencing. If the absence of scientific support is inadequate to persuade you to go to a professional instead, the fact that there is no support also suggests that taking an at-home food level of sensitivity test will simply show an inconvenience. As Great, RX Health notes, you will need to spend for a test and after that in all probability, need to take a test when you go to the expert anyway - how accurate is everlywell std test.

As the certified dietician Tamara Duker Freuman wrote in a piece for Self, an expert would rather you not take a test prior to seeing them. That's since they need to dispel any concepts that the test had actually provided the client. The best case circumstances are those in which the client listens.

Worst case scenarios involve patients who bought into the outcomes of food sensitivity tests entirely - how accurate is everlywell std test. "I have actually watched helplessly as my client disappears down a rabbit hole of food constraint and avoidance that can, for some individuals, result in disordered eating," Freuman shared, explaining how clients assume they just need to get rid of more food from their diet plan.
